Other Carnivorous Plants Other companion plants for the bog garden should be slow growing and not get too large. Some available ones include bog buttons (eriocaulon), marsh-pinks (sabatia), and rose pogonia orchids (Pogonia ophioglossoides) and ladies-tresses orchids (Spiranthes cernuua 'Chadd's Ford').

Can I plant my Venus flytrap in moss?

The flytrap requires nutrient-free soil that provides good drainage and aeration. Use a standard soil mixture of 1 part peat moss and 1 part perlite. Never use potting soil, compost or fertilizer. These ingredients will kill your plant.

Can I put a Venus flytrap in Miracle Grow?

WARNING: Miracle Grow or Scott's sphagnum peat moss has fertilizers added which can kill your flytrap. Never fertilize! Venus flytrap do not appreciate fertilizer for the same reason that they usually die from tap water: too many minerals and chemicals. These burn the plants' roots and kill them.

Should I repot my Venus flytrap after buying it?

Repot Venus fly traps every year or two, selecting a slightly larger pot and changing the growing medium each time. The best time to repot a fly trap is in the early spring.

How long do Venus flytraps live?

It is estimated that Venus flytrap plants can live up to 20 years in the wild, possibly longer.

How many times can a Venus flytrap close before it dies?

As the insect struggles to escape, it triggers even more outgrowths, causing the Venus flytrap to tighten its grip and release enzymes to digest its snack. Each "mouth" can only snap shut four or five times before it dies, whether it catches something or not.

Should I cut off black Venus flytraps?

Cut off dead flowers with scissors – and in the case of Venus flytraps and pitcher plants, cut off the dead traps if they go black – this often happens in autumn and winter.

Why is my Venus flytrap not catching flies?

The trick is that the prey must be alive when caught. Dead flies won't work in Venus flytrap feeding; the insect must move around inside the trap to trigger it to close and begin digesting the food. It also needs to be small enough that the trap can close tightly around it to keep out bacteria.

How hard is it to keep a Venus flytrap alive?

In many respects, flytraps should be easy. They don't require fertilizing. They can survive under full sun or fluorescent lights. Unlike so many other houseplants, they can sit in a half-inch of standing water without fear of roots rotting.
